MSVidStreamBufferSource オブジェクト
このトピックは Windows XP Service Pack 1 にのみ適用。
MSVidStreamBufferSource オブジェクトは、ストリーム バッファ ソース オブジェクトを表す。
このオブジェクトは以下の CLSID を持つ。
{AD8E510D-217F-409b-8076-29C5E73B98E8}
このオブジェクトは IMSVidPlayback オブジェクトのすべてのメソッドとプロパティを継承する。さらに、以下のメソッドとプロパティを公開する。
プロパティ | 説明 |
BlockUnrated | 未評価のコンテンツをブロックするかどうかを指定する。 |
RecordingAttribute | ストリーム バッファ ソース フィルタを取得する。 |
SBESource | ストリーム バッファ ソース フィルタを取得する。 |
Start | 開始タイムを取得する。 |
UnratedDelay | オブジェクトが未評価のコンテンツをブロックする前に再生する時間の長さを指定する。 |
メソッド | 説明 |
CurrentRatings | データ ソースから現在のレーティング情報を取得する。 |
MaxRatingsLevel | オブジェクトが再生を許可されている最大レーティング レベルを指定する。 |
MSVidStreamBufferSource オブジェクトは以下のイベントを発行する。
イベント | 説明 |
CertificateFailure | オブジェクトが暗号化/暗号解除ライセンスの取得に失敗した場合に発行される。 |
CertificateSuccess | オブジェクトが暗号化/暗号解除ライセンスの取得に成功した場合に発行される。 |
ContentBecomingStale | ストリーム バッファ ソースがストリーム バッファ シンクより遅れているときに発行される。 |
EndOfMedia | オブジェクトがソース ファイルの最後に達したときに発行される。 |
RatingsBlocked | オブジェクトが再生をブロックしたときに発行される。 |
RatingsChanged | コンテンツのレーティングが変化したときに発行される。 |
RatingsUnblocked | オブジェクトが再生のブロックを解除したときに発行される。 |
StaleDataRead | オブジェクトが削除対象のマークが付いている一時記録ファイルから読み込みを行ったときに発行される。 |
StaleFileDeleted | 一時記録ファイルが削除されたときに発行される。 |
TimeHole | 再生が記録したコンテンツのギャップに達したときに発行される。 |